Here is a toolkit from Autism Speaks about AS and HFA. The toolkit includes explanations of the two diagnoses, ideas for school and information about transitioning into adulthood. The Early Start Denver Model was ranked fifth in the top 10 medical breakthroughs of 2012 in Time Magazine. Read about it here: http://healthland.time.com/2012/12/04/top-10-health-lists/slide/hope-for-reversing-autism/#ixzz2E8P2qTfA
